Output 7caaaca3140540f0e395f4fbcaa2374ede77f8d7b7abb1d24d3614526fd55a23:0

value
25454800
script pubkey
OP_0 OP_PUSHBYTES_20 8b47cb49cf4e5108fb0efe0377aea408f1d0af62
address
bc1q3drukjw0fegs37cwlcph0t4yprcaptmz4qv6r0
transaction
7caaaca3140540f0e395f4fbcaa2374ede77f8d7b7abb1d24d3614526fd55a23
spent
false

86 Sat Ranges